OK another newbie question if I'm not pushing my luck here..... how do you add the text in your comments that say you appreciate them? I've seen a few of you have that when I go to comment and I thought it was a really nice touch.
This one is easy -
I hope everyone uses blogger because that is the only way I know how to do this
log into dashboard
go to the SETTING tab
the go to COMMENTS
scroll down the page - you will see a box that says COMMENT FORM MESSAGE
add whatever you want to say there - then scroll all the way down to the bottom of the page and click SAVE SETTINGS.
